Output ecf38641ae177e508c5ba3089c65140d17413cc5ad8b6c42cbed4fdb04158c97:0

value
18100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c20d4055e3a095079c274f3032e7143f89baf0d9 OP_EQUALVERIFY OP_CHECKSIG
address
1Jh3xw5G4Ap8RTv1MaqRvGyofRT2CMEjhZ
transaction
ecf38641ae177e508c5ba3089c65140d17413cc5ad8b6c42cbed4fdb04158c97
spent
true